Public Works Protects:
The California Labor Code beginning at section 1720 deals with this issue. Labor Code sections 1720 and
1771 define public works as work done under contract and paid for in whole or in part out of public funds
that involves one or more of the following: Construction;Alteration, Demolition, Installation; Repair/
Maintenance work. Contractor shall comply with all prevailing wage laws, rules and regulations on public
works projects. A complete definition may be found at: http://www.lectinfo.calov/calaw.html.
